WebThe difference between expect and anticipate is based on their Latin roots. Expect From ex (out of) spectare (looking) to look forward to. This is a passive conclusion or belief. Anticipate From anti (before) capere (take) This is active processing, planning, or acting … WebJan 28, 2024 · Workers of the ant Myrmica sabuleti have been previously shown to be able to add and subtract numbers of elements and to expect the time and location of the next food delivery.
